Drawn from its portfolio of high-performance polymers, UV-resistant DuPont™ Rynite® PET resins offer an excellent balance of properties which makes them an ideal candidate for the cost-effective manufacturing of photovoltaic module frames and components.
Two specific grades are currently available from DuPont for these applications: Rynite® 935SUV is a 35% glass-fiber/mineral reinforced, UV stabilized grade of polyethylene terephtalate (PET) suitable for injection molding; Rynite® 540SUV is a 40% glass-fiber reinforced, UV stabilized grade of PET suitable for extrusion and injection molding.
Both grades combine high stiffness with low warpage and have been specifically developed for long-term outdoor applications. Other DuPont engineering polymers for the photovoltaic sector include flame-retardant DuPont™ Zytel® nylon for junction boxes and inverters, and low-wear/low-friction DuPont™ Delrin® acetal resin for bearings used in sun-tracking mirror installations, for example.
When used in photovoltaic applications, DuPont’s polymers can help increase design flexibility for greater ease of assembly and installation; provide an opportunity for functional integration (thereby reducing the overall number of components); and when produced in large numbers, offer one of the most cost-competitive methods of production through injection molding and extrusion.
Moreover, high performance thermoplastics such as Rynite® can offer a high degree of stiffness for structural strength, excellent outdoor performance, high impact resistance, corrosion resistance and good aesthetics. By using Rynite® PET for frames, resistance to ultraviolet rays, heat, wind and significant loads of snow is assured, as well as enhanced durability and a high surface finish.
